Other M slightly underperformed for a Metroid game in Japan and massively underperformed in the traditional stronghold of the series in the US and the PAL territories. Without getting into the gory detail of the poorly-planned and very intrusive narrative, the game still was a major disappointment for Nintendo. We got an Other M stage most likely for the same reason we got a fair bit if Sonic '06stuff in Brawl: Development started when it was thought it could still be salvaged somewhat.
